Abubakar Shekau
Gatekeepers News reports that the Boko Haram leader, Abubakar Shekau was reportedly killed during a tough fight between the rival groups in their Sambisa Forest hideouts on Wednesday.
Shekau was not directly killed by ISWAP but blew himself up to avoid being captured, Gatekeepers News gathered.
“Intelligence sources have confirmed dt (sic) #BH #JAS Leader, Abubakar Shekau is finally dead. This was following d (sic)#ISWAP attack on Sambisa fortress of #shekau led by ISWAP commander, Baana DUGURI. Shekau was said to have blew (sic) himself to avoid being captured alive,” Eons Intelligence said via Twitter on Thursday.
There is, however, no official confirmation on Shekau’s death as at the time Gatekeepers News filed this report.
